I had an inspector fail me for not putting a label on the front of my 100A 480 service disconnect stated the date and amount the interrupting current was calculated for. I have never heard of this and can't find it in my 2014 code book. I called the power company, they told me it was calculated at 9191amps on February 6. I put that on a label and stuck it on and the inspector was happy and he said he would email where it states that requirement in the code book. I'm anxiously awaiting his email because I can't find anything relevant. :?:?
